Caption

House Resolution Amending The Rules Of The House Of Representatives For The Years 2021 And 2022 (amends The House Rules To Permit A Member To Vote By Proxy When The Member Is Unable To Be Physically Present Due To A Health Condition.)

Impact

If passed, this amendment would significantly alter the current voting procedures within the House of Representatives. The new proxy voting rule would empower the Speaker to authorize such votes, contingent on the submission of a written request supported by a physician's letter. Summary

House Bill 5131 proposes an amendment to the rules governing the House of Representatives, specifically allowing members to cast votes by proxy if they are unable to attend in person due to health conditions. This amendment is aimed at accommodating members who, for various medical reasons, cannot physically participate in legislative sessions, thereby ensuring their ability to engage in the democratic process and maintain representation in the legislature.
